Title:
PLATE THICKNESS CONTROL METHOD IN THICK PLATE ROLLING
Document Type and Number:
Japanese Patent JP2016131975
Kind Code:
A
Abstract:
PROBLEM TO BE SOLVED: To provide a plate thickness control method in thick plate rolling which can prevent the minus crown of a bite-in end and that of a bite-off end from getting excessive over a stationary part even when a slab is heated higher at both longitudinal ends than at the center.SOLUTION: A plate thickness control method has: the process (step 100, 110) for applying an estimated rolling load of rolling and a set bending force before the rolling to a plate crown estimated model to calculate a plate crown amount, and for previously determining an influence coefficient for a change in rolling load influencing an obtained plate crown amount and for a change in bending force, respectively; and the process (steps 200, 210, 220) for calculating a plate crown amount from an actual rolling load and an actual bending force by using the predetermined influence coefficient, and for increasing a target outlet side plate thickness of an automatic plate thickness control (AGC) by a fall of the obtained plate crown amount as the obtained plate crown amount falls below a predetermined threshold value.SELECTED DRAWING: Figure 1
